    *Oooh Ecclesiastes. You do know the purpose of Ecclesiastes right? It's basically Solomon going through a mid-life crisis. Trying to figure out the meaning of life as he realizes that everything around him is temporary. He also says in that same book that life is futile. I'm sure we can all relate to that right? Times when we thought life was futile.
